Remove plugs. If it’s a truck, drain all fluids. Diffs, trans, t-case, oil. Put some oil on pistons, let it sit, then manually crank motor as he said. Make sure everything is clean and smooth turning.

I think the biggest issue which is truly unfixable is that any of the wire ends that were submerged in saltwater will have wicked up the water and over time will corrode. The only solution is a complete new wire harness. But I would think you you can still get many years of use out of the car before the wire totally disintegrates.

Actually, crimping is faster to do, and stronger than soldering. Also not as dangerous. Not every wire must be soldered, or can be soldered. Using the correct connector, and the correct tool to crimp, is the better way to go. He used the correct crimping tool for the job he was doing.
